The title page of this scan shows an incorrect opus number (Op. 41) and is incorrectly subtitled "From 24 Esquisses". The file was therefore originally uploaded with an incorrect filename. The 24 Esquisses comprise a completely separate set of 24 pieces composed 1905-1915. These "10 Little Easy Pieces" Op. 62(B) were composed later (1919-1920). None of them figure among the 24 Esquisses. The opus no. 62(B) has been confirmed by Koechlin's complete catalogue of works, published recently in France ("L'oevre de Charles Koechlin - Introduction de Henri Sauguet")
